Cutting-Edge Surveillance

The landscape of security and technology is rapidly evolving with the emergence of smart cameras. These innovative devices are no longer simply passive observers; they are becoming increasingly intelligent thanks to the integration of artificial intelligence (AI). By harnessing the power of machine learning algorithms, smart cameras can now analyze visual data with a level of accuracy and granularity that was previously unimaginable. This allows them to perform a wide range of tasks, from identifying objects and movements to activating to specific events in real time.

Capturing the Moment: Exploring the Evolution of Camera Design

From cumbersome brass contraptions to sleek modern marvels, the journey of camera design is a intriguing tale. Early cameramen relied on large-format plates and intricate mechanisms to capture fleeting moments, often demanding hours of setup and meticulous development. The advent of film revolutionized the process, making photography more convenient. Breakthroughs such as the 35mm format and rangefinders further simplified photography, placing the power camera industrial to create images in the hands of the masses. Today, with the rise of digital cameras, image capture is nearly immediate, blurring the lines between photographer and everyday user.

This ongoing evolution shows no signs of slowing down, with emerging technologies like artificial intelligence and augmented reality promising to further transform the way we capture and interact with moments in time.
